Output ead0d64d79d0af84ddf266e8f10f569549d1644bf0b33d14609f54a8bcdf9491:5

value
42872114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b8034f503ec638ecef3a8966ed654e39c8b1fc1 OP_EQUAL
address
MWpyRYmzwJjbdgPMTfEJqsx1KzWKHfFp4o
transaction
ead0d64d79d0af84ddf266e8f10f569549d1644bf0b33d14609f54a8bcdf9491
spent
true